Profile of woozle

EN
Name
woozle
Town
Coburg (Bavaria)
Country
Germany

Status

Member since
Mon, 29 Jul 13 (11y 8m)
Last here
Fri, 5 Jul 24, 18:05 (8m 28d)
Friend of